vscode-github-actions icon indicating copy to clipboard operation
vscode-github-actions copied to clipboard

Request textDocument/hover failed

Open mu88 opened this issue 5 months ago • 0 comments

Describe the bug When hovering over any of my GitHub Action definitions, I constantly see an error toaster with the error message Request textDocument/hover failed.

To Reproduce Steps to reproduce the behavior:

  1. Open any GitHub Action from https://github.com/organizationOfMyCompany
  2. Hover over the GitHub Action in the editor pane.
  3. The error toaster appears.

Expected behavior No error toaster appears.

Screenshots / Logs Here are the VS Code logs:

GET /user - 500 with id UNKNOWN in 11ms
Failure to retrieve username:  Xi [HttpError]: connect EACCES <<some IP address>>:443
    at Zi (c:\Users\myUser\.vscode\extensions\github.vscode-github-actions-0.27.2\dist\server-node.js:1:2481429)
    at process.processTicksAndRejections (node:internal/process/task_queues:105:5)
    at async c:\Users\myUser\.vscode\extensions\github.vscode-github-actions-0.27.2\dist\server-node.js:1:2572921
    ... 5 lines matching cause stack trace ...
    at async yn (c:\Users\myUser\.vscode\extensions\github.vscode-github-actions-0.27.2\dist\server-node.js:1:2437365)
    at async c:\Users\myUser\.vscode\extensions\github.vscode-github-actions-0.27.2\dist\server-node.js:1:2586783 {
  status: 500,
  request: {
    method: 'GET',
    url: 'https://api.github.com/user',
    headers: {
      accept: 'application/vnd.github.v3+json',
      'user-agent': 'VS Code GitHub Actions (0.27.2) octokit-rest.js/21.1.1 octokit-core.js/6.1.5 Node.js/22',
      authorization: 'token [REDACTED]'
    },
    request: { hook: [Function: bound bound ji] }
  },
  response: undefined,
  cause: TypeError: fetch failed
      at node:internal/deps/undici/undici:13510:13
      at process.processTicksAndRejections (node:internal/process/task_queues:105:5)
      at async Zi (c:\Users\myUser\.vscode\extensions\github.vscode-github-actions-0.27.2\dist\server-node.js:1:2481060)
      at async c:\Users\myUser\.vscode\extensions\github.vscode-github-actions-0.27.2\dist\server-node.js:1:2572921
      at async Us.get (c:\Users\myUser\.vscode\extensions\github.vscode-github-actions-0.27.2\dist\server-node.js:1:2583112)
      at async c:\Users\myUser\.vscode\extensions\github.vscode-github-actions-0.27.2\dist\server-node.js:1:2572856
      at async As (c:\Users\myUser\.vscode\extensions\github.vscode-github-actions-0.27.2\dist\server-node.js:1:2572823)
      at async c:\Users\myUser\.vscode\extensions\github.vscode-github-actions-0.27.2\dist\server-node.js:1:2576671
      at async Object.getContext (c:\Users\myUser\.vscode\extensions\github.vscode-github-actions-0.27.2\dist\server-node.js:1:2576627)
      at async yn (c:\Users\myUser\.vscode\extensions\github.vscode-github-actions-0.27.2\dist\server-node.js:1:2437365) {
    [cause]: Error: connect EACCES <<some IP address>>:443
        at TCPConnectWrap.afterConnect [as oncomplete] (node:net:1636:16) {
      errno: -4092,
      code: 'EACCES',
      syscall: 'connect',
      address: '<<some IP address>>',
      port: 443
    }
  }
}
[Error - 1:01:01 PM] Request textDocument/hover failed.
  Message: Request textDocument/hover failed with message: connect EACCES <<some IP address>>:443
  Code: -32603 
GET /user - 500 with id UNKNOWN in 4ms
Failure to retrieve username:  Xi [HttpError]: connect EACCES <<some IP address>>:443
    at Zi (c:\Users\myUser\.vscode\extensions\github.vscode-github-actions-0.27.2\dist\server-node.js:1:2481429)
    at process.processTicksAndRejections (node:internal/process/task_queues:105:5)
    at async c:\Users\myUser\.vscode\extensions\github.vscode-github-actions-0.27.2\dist\server-node.js:1:2572921
    ... 5 lines matching cause stack trace ...
    at async yn (c:\Users\myUser\.vscode\extensions\github.vscode-github-actions-0.27.2\dist\server-node.js:1:2437365)
    at async c:\Users\myUser\.vscode\extensions\github.vscode-github-actions-0.27.2\dist\server-node.js:1:2586783 {
  status: 500,
  request: {
    method: 'GET',
    url: 'https://api.github.com/user',
    headers: {
      accept: 'application/vnd.github.v3+json',
      'user-agent': 'VS Code GitHub Actions (0.27.2) octokit-rest.js/21.1.1 octokit-core.js/6.1.5 Node.js/22',
      authorization: 'token [REDACTED]'
    },
    request: { hook: [Function: bound bound ji] }
  },
  response: undefined,
  cause: TypeError: fetch failed
      at node:internal/deps/undici/undici:13510:13
      at process.processTicksAndRejections (node:internal/process/task_queues:105:5)
      at async Zi (c:\Users\myUser\.vscode\extensions\github.vscode-github-actions-0.27.2\dist\server-node.js:1:2481060)
      at async c:\Users\myUser\.vscode\extensions\github.vscode-github-actions-0.27.2\dist\server-node.js:1:2572921
      at async Us.get (c:\Users\myUser\.vscode\extensions\github.vscode-github-actions-0.27.2\dist\server-node.js:1:2583112)
      at async c:\Users\myUser\.vscode\extensions\github.vscode-github-actions-0.27.2\dist\server-node.js:1:2572856
      at async As (c:\Users\myUser\.vscode\extensions\github.vscode-github-actions-0.27.2\dist\server-node.js:1:2572823)
      at async c:\Users\myUser\.vscode\extensions\github.vscode-github-actions-0.27.2\dist\server-node.js:1:2576671
      at async Object.getContext (c:\Users\myUser\.vscode\extensions\github.vscode-github-actions-0.27.2\dist\server-node.js:1:2576627)
      at async yn (c:\Users\myUser\.vscode\extensions\github.vscode-github-actions-0.27.2\dist\server-node.js:1:2437365) {
    [cause]: Error: connect EACCES <<some IP address>>:443
        at TCPConnectWrap.afterConnect [as oncomplete] (node:net:1636:16) {
      errno: -4092,
      code: 'EACCES',
      syscall: 'connect',
      address: '<<some IP address>>',
      port: 443
    }
  }
}
[Error - 1:01:02 PM] Request textDocument/hover failed.
  Message: Request textDocument/hover failed with message: connect EACCES <<some IP address>>:443
  Code: -32603 

Extension Version v0.27.2

Additional context /

mu88 avatar Aug 12 '25 11:08 mu88